目錄
Toggle什麼是 Excel 空格補 0?空白與空格的正確定義
在 Excel 處理大量數據時,經常會遇到儲存格「空白」或「空格」的情況。這兩者雖然名稱相似,但在 Excel 裡有明顯差異:
- 空白儲存格:完全沒有內容的儲存格(即內容為空)。
- 空格儲存格:儲存格內含有空格字元(如按下空白鍵),但看起來像是空的。
本篇教學以「補齊空白儲存格為 0」為主,若需處理含空格字元的情境,請參考下方常見問題區。
適用場景與實務應用
將空白補 0 的需求常見於以下情境:
- 整理財務報表時,需將未填寫欄位補 0 以利計算總和。
- 問卷資料整併,將未作答欄位統一補 0。
- 數據分析前,需確保所有數值欄位皆有內容,避免計算錯誤。
選擇合適的補零方法,能大幅提升資料處理效率與準確性。
方法一:使用公式自動補零(最推薦,彈性高)
步驟說明
-
選擇目標儲存格範圍
假設原始數據在 A 欄,欲在 B 欄顯示補零後結果。 -
輸入公式
在 B1 輸入:
=IF(A1="", 0, A1)
這個公式會判斷 A1 是否為空白,若是則顯示 0,否則顯示原值。 -
批次填充公式
點選 B1 儲存格右下角的小方塊,向下拖曳至所需範圍。
小技巧:選取整列後,按下Ctrl+D
可快速填充。
優缺點
優點 | 缺點 |
---|---|
不會改動原始數據,彈性高 | 需另開一欄顯示結果 |
適用情境
- 需保留原始資料不被覆蓋
- 需進行進一步公式運算
方法二:查找與替換功能補零(適合直接覆蓋原資料)
步驟說明
-
選取欲處理範圍
建議先複製一份原始資料,避免誤操作。 -
開啟查找與替換
按下Ctrl + H
。 -
設定查找條件
- 若要補「空白儲存格」:
在「查找內容」留空(不要輸入任何字元)。 -
若要補「空格字元」:
在「查找內容」輸入一個空格。 -
設定替換條件
在「替換為」輸入 0。 -
執行全部替換
點擊「全部替換」,Excel 會將選取範圍內的空白(或空格)全部補為 0。
優缺點
優點 | 缺點 |
---|---|
操作快速,直接修改原資料 | 不可回復,建議先備份;易誤補含空格的儲存格 |
適用情境
- 需直接在原資料上補零
- 資料量大、需快速處理
方法三:批次選取空白儲存格快速補零(高效技巧)
這是許多進階用戶愛用的技巧,能一次選取所有空白儲存格並批量輸入 0。
步驟說明
-
選取欲處理範圍
例如選取 A1:A100。 -
選取空白儲存格
按下Ctrl + G
(定位),點選「特殊」,選擇「空值」。 -
批次輸入 0
直接輸入0
,不要按 Enter。 -
套用至所有空白儲存格
按下Ctrl + Enter
,所有選取的空白儲存格即同時填入 0。
優缺點
優點 | 缺點 |
---|---|
一步到位,效率極高 | 只適用於空白儲存格,無法處理含空格字元 |
適用情境
- 大量空白欄位需補零
- 不需保留原始空白狀態
方法四:VBA 宏自動補零(適合進階自動化)
若需經常重複補零操作,或處理大量資料,可考慮使用 VBA 宏。
步驟說明
-
開啟 VBA 編輯器
按下Alt + F11
。 -
插入新模組
點選「插入」>「模組」。 -
貼上下列程式碼
Sub ReplaceBlanksWithZeros()
Dim cell As Range
For Each cell In Selection
If IsEmpty(cell) Then
cell.Value = 0
End If
Next cell
End Sub -
儲存並關閉 VBA 編輯器。
-
選取欲補零範圍,執行巨集
回到 Excel,選取範圍,按Alt + F8
,選擇ReplaceBlanksWithZeros
,點擊「執行」。
優缺點
優點 | 缺點 |
---|---|
可自動化大量重複操作 | 需開啟巨集權限,初學者需學習 VBA 基礎 |
適用情境
- 頻繁需補零的自動化流程
- 處理超大量資料
方法五:顯示或隱藏零值設定(視覺呈現調整)
有時候,僅需調整 Excel 顯示方式,讓 0 值顯示或隱藏。
操作步驟
- 點選「檔案」>「選項」>「進階」。
- 在「顯示選項」中,勾選或取消「在具有零值的儲存格顯示零」。
- 按下確定。
此方法僅影響顯示,不會更改儲存格實際內容。
三種主要補零方法比較表
方法 | 操作難易度 | 是否改動原資料 | 適用情境 | 需不需額外權限 |
---|---|---|---|---|
公式補零 | 低 | 否 | 需保留原始資料 | 否 |
查找與替換 | 低 | 是 | 快速批量處理 | 否 |
批次選取空白儲存格 | 中 | 是 | 高效大量補零 | 否 |
VBA 宏 | 高 | 是 | 需自動化或大量處理 | 是 |
進階應用:自動化補零與團隊協作工具
若你需要更高層次的自動化或團隊協作,建議考慮專業工具:
- Monday.com:支援自動化數據清理與流程管理,適合專案團隊批量處理資料。
- ClickUp:結合 AI 與自動化功能,能快速整理與補齊資料,提升團隊效率。
- Notion:適合彈性記錄與協作,當 Excel 無法滿足複雜需求時可考慮轉用。
根據實際需求選擇,若僅需單次補零,Excel 內建方法已足夠;若需頻繁自動化或多人協作,推薦上述工具。
常見問題 FAQ
Q1. 空白與空格有什麼差別?如何分辨?
- 空白儲存格:完全沒有內容(公式
=ISBLANK(A1)
為 TRUE)。 - 含空格儲存格:看似空白,但實際有空格字元(
=LEN(A1)
> 0)。
Q2. 為什麼補零後格式異常?
- 若原本欄位為文字格式,補入 0 可能仍為文字型態,建議確認格式或重新設定為數值。
Q3. 如何只補特定範圍的空白?
- 先選取欲處理範圍,再執行上述方法,避免影響其他資料。
Q4. 如何批次清除含空格字元的儲存格?
- 使用「查找與替換」,在「查找內容」輸入一個空格,將「替換為」留空或輸入 0。
Q5. Google Sheets 可以怎麼做?
- 公式法同樣適用:
=IF(A1="", 0, A1)
- 也可用 Apps Script 寫自動化腳本。
結論與選擇建議
Excel 提供多種補零方法,從公式、查找替換、批次填補到 VBA 自動化,皆可根據需求靈活運用。
若需更高層次的自動化與團隊協作,建議嘗試 Monday.com、ClickUp 等專業工具。
想精進 Excel 技能,也可參考 Coursera 的專業課程,系統學習進階技巧。
根據你的實際情境,選擇最適合的方法,讓數據處理更高效、專案管理更順暢!